美团秋招后端一二面面经
实习,项目
看我主要用C++,又没问Java
redis
redis基本数据类型,应用场景
redis实现共同关注
redis持久化,AOF,RDB,会丢数据吗?
redis穿透击穿雪崩,解决
redis大Key,怎么处理
redis分布式锁,Zookeeper分布式锁,怎么选择
熔断与限流
为什么kafka多用于消息中转,很少用于实时计算
kafka高可用,高吞吐
kafka不重不丢
kafka消费端幂等性
kafka消费者群组
kafka生产端分配,路由
mysql索引,为什么B+树
主键索引,二级索引
mysql ACID
mysql事务隔离级别,RR解决幻读吗?什么场景下会幻读?
MVCC,事务版本号怎么生成,存在哪里
binlog,redolog,undolog
挂了用什么log,主从同步用什么log
binlog的两阶段提交
大文件排序
场景题,不会
算法题:买卖股票
二面:
深挖项目
TCP和UDP
TCP可靠机制
Mysql引擎
Mysql索引,为什么是B+树
索引失效
A < x and B=y and C >z 怎么加索引,顺序有关吗?
脏读,不可重复读,幻读
Mysql事务隔离级别,怎么解决,MVCC+next-key lock可以解决幻读吗?
算法题:树的先中后序遍历,二进制加法
#美团##秋招##后端#